I was gifted this family heirloom. It was my great grandfather's. He acquired it through sketchy circumstances and the serial and reference numbers were scratched off. It looks like a ref. 6107 face with a ref. 6480 case and lug.
Some help would be appreciated. I believe it's an 6352 but it also looks like a 6107. I am unsure and could use some help. It has been passed down from my great grandfather. There are no serial or reference numbers so I am having a hard time. Any help is appreciated. Last edited by Tools; 11 January 2025 at 03:28 AM.. |
